What is the origin of the last name Sundara?

The last name "Sundara" is of Indian origin. In Sanskrit, "Sundara" means "beautiful" or "handsome." It is a common surname in India, particularly in the southern states such as Tamil Nadu and Kerala. The name is often used in conjunction with given names to form full names.

The meaning and origin of the last name Sundara

The surname Sundara is of Indian origin and is derived from the Sanskrit word "sundara", which means "beautiful" or "handsome". It is often used as a given name in South Asian countries, particularly in India and Sri Lanka. The name's origins can be traced back to ancient Indian mythology and literature, where it is frequently used to describe gods, goddesses, and heroic figures known for their beauty and grace. Over time, the name has evolved into a popular surname used by individuals and families in South Asia and around the world. Geographical distribution of the last name Sundara

The last name Sundara is predominantly found in South India, particularly in the states of Tamil Nadu, Karnataka, and Kerala. It is a relatively common surname among the Tamil-speaking population in these regions. The name is of Indian origin and is often associated with the Hindu deity Lord Shiva, who is often referred to as Sundara. Outside of India, the surname Sundara can also be found among the Indian diaspora in countries such as the United States, Canada, the United Kingdom, and Australia. Overall, the distribution of the last name Sundara is closely tied to the historical and cultural connections of the Tamil community in South India and the migration patterns of Indians settling abroad.
